‘When Dhoni stepped away, Kohli-Shastri toughened Indian cricket’: Rahane

Ajinkya Rahane believes Virat Kohli and Ravi Shastri toughened Indian cricket. They instilled a fearless and aggressive approach, especially in overseas matches. India achieved significant success under their leadership during this period. Rahane expressed concern about the current Test cricket mentality and resilience. He noted a decline in the patience required for difficult match phases.
